IMED 2315 - Web Design II

3 credit hours. 2 lecture hours. 2 lab hours.
Prerequisites: IMED 1316  
Mark-up language and advanced layout techniques for creating web pages. Emphasis on identifying the target audience and producing web sites, according to accessibility standards, cultural appearance, and legal issues. This course is offered in the spring semester.

Additional Fees: Lab fee $24

Measurable Learning Outcomes:
Demonstrate the use of World Wide Web Consortium (W3C) standards for style, accessibility, layout, and formatting. Build web pages with dynamic customization capabilities. Develop web sites designed for usability and cultural diversity. Use design strategies for search engine optimization.
